QBE Re eyes growth in Sub Saharan Africa with new hire

QBE Re has hired a new head of Africa as it targets expansion of the business in that continent beyond the North African region it has traditionally focused on.

Attilio Tornetta becomes head of Africa at QBE Re and from April 1 is responsible for all new treaty business. He is based in Dubai and reports to Houcine Zouaoui, head of treaty for the Middle East and Africa.

Tornetta joins from MGA Fourteenzerofive where he was lead underwriter. He has more than a decade of experience in the African market, having led the Sub-Saharan African business at Aspen Re and Swiss Re.

Abdallah Balbeisi, senior executive officer for Middle East and Africa at QBE Re, said: “Our appetite includes the selective writing of proportional multi line and bouquets as well as XOL business, offering a wide range of products across property, casualty and specialty lines of business.”
